(MUSICIANS AND SINGERS SING WHILE PEOPLE ARE BEING SEATED; ON LAST SONG - WHEN THEY FINISH...)

LEADER:

Baruch Atah YHVH Elohaenu Melech ha-olam.  Blessed art Thou YHVH our-God King of the universe.

Baruch haba B'Shem YHVH.  Blessed is he who comes in the Name of YHVH.

(HUSBAND LIGHTS LEFT CANDLE; THEN ENTERS WEDDING CANOPY.)

LEADER:

Baruch habaah b'Shem YHVH.

Blessed is she who comes in the Name of YHVH.

(MUSICIAN BEGINS ENTRANCE SONG FOR THE WIFE)

(WIFE CIRCLES WEDDING CANOPY SEVEN TIMES; & LIGHTS RIGHT CANDLE; THEN ENTERS CANOPY.)

(LEADER BEGINS - AS SOON AS MUSIC STOPS...)

LEADER:

Baruch Atah YHVH, Elohaenu Melech ha-olam, she-he-cheynu, v'keey'manu, v'higee'anu la-z'man
ha-zeh.

Blessed art Thou, YHVH our-God, King of the universe, Who has kept us in life and persevered us and enabled us to reach this time.

As the bride circles the wedding canopy seven times; we're reminded that Elohim created everything through His Word in six days; and on the Seventh, the Shabbat, He rested.  So the woman was brought to the man on the 6th day: and they were to dwell together on the Shabbat, for all eternity, in love.

So today YHVH, in His will, brings a couple together; and if they both dwell in Yeshua The Word of God - they will dwell in a Shabbat rest with Him forever.

Blessed art Thou, YHVH our God, King of the universe, Who formed man from the dust of the earth and brought forth to him a woman made out of his side to be a helpmate.  HaShem, blessed be He,  who creates groom and bride, love and shalom, joy and gladness, mercy and compassion.  He commands to be fruitful and multiply; He strengthens the husband to walk as a priest before Him;  He enables the wife as a fruitful vine; and blesses them with children to raise up in His ways.

Blessed art Thou, YHVH our God, Who gives joy to the groom and the bride.

May there soon be heard in the streets of Yerushalayim the sound of the footsteps of Messiah,  the sounds of joy and gladness, and the sounds of the wedding celebration.

LEADER:

May Elohim bless this couple as they come to re-affirm their vows and re-dedicate their marriage anew before the Father, in the Presence of The Holy Spirit, in the Name of Yeshua HaMashiach; Amaine.

{______ & ______}:  Elohim/God in His Holy Scriptures has given commandments to remember and perform in your lives and marriage.

When Yeshua, was asked what is the first and greatest commandment, He responded from this passage in Tanakh - {the Older Covenant}....

"Hear O Israel, YHVH our God, YHVH He is One; and you shall love YHVH your God with all your heart, and with all your soul, and with all your might. ..."

Loving Elohim/God with your whole self; let your course in life be to always...

"...seek  ye first the Kingdom of God and His righteousness; and all these things shall be added unto you."

The second commandment, Messiah told us, that is like unto the first is this...

"Love thy neighbor as thyself."

Scripture tells wives to:

"...love their husbands...";

and to:

"...submit yourselves to your own husbands, as to the Lord"

And to husbands it says:

"...love your wives, even as Messiah also loved the Congregation, and gave Himself for it"

Nevertheless, one is not to use authority as a means of oppression, for in the same place in Scripture we are told...

"Submitting yourselves one to another in the fear of God" -
            
For:
         
"...neither is the man without the woman, neither the woman without the man, in the Lord."

And:

"...Love is patient, (and) is kind; love does not envy; love is not boastful, and is not arrogant; does not behave rudely, does not seek it's own, is not provoked, thinks no evil; does not rejoice in iniquity, but rejoices in the truth; bears all things, believes all things, hopes all things, endures all things.  Love never fails ..."

And again to both of you G*d says in His Word...

"... Let these matters that I command you today be upon your heart.  Teach them diligently to your children and speak of them while you sit in your home, while you walk on the way, when you lie down, and when you rise up.  Bind them as a sign upon your arm and let them be a sign between your eyes.  And write them on the doorposts of your house and upon your gates."

Also concerning both of you, on love for your children...

"Train up a child in the way he should go, and when he is old he will not depart from it."

And to you fathers...

"Fathers, do not provoke your children to anger, but bring them up in the fear and admonition of the Lord."

And to mothers the Bible says for...

"...women to be sober minded, to love their husbands, to love their children, (To be) discreet, chaste, keepers at home, good, obedient to their own husbands, that the Word of God be not blasphemed."

HUSBAND & WIFE: (LIGHT CENTER CANDLE.)

LEADER:

"... For this cause shall a man leave father and mother, and shall cleave to his wife: and they two shall be one flesh?  Wherefore they are not more two, but one flesh.  Therefore what Elohim/God hath joined together, let not man put asunder."

LEADER:

{____}/(HUSBAND): Do you acknowledge in front of Elohim/God and these witnesses, mindful of the Torah delivered to Moshe, the Prophets and Writings of Tanakh, and the Word of Yeshua Messiah as delivered in the New Covenant to you who Believe; to love honor cherish and respect {_____} your wife; and in so doing to re-affirm your love for her?

HUSBAND:

Yes; Ani l'dodi v'dodi lee.

(HUSBAND GIVES WIFE HER RING)

LEADER:

{_____}/(WIFE): Do you acknowledge in front of Elohim/God and these witnesses, mindful of the Torah delivered to Moshe, the Prophets and Writings of Tanakh, and the Word of Yeshua Messiah as delivered in the New Covenant to you who Believe; to love honor cherish and obey {_____} your husband; and in so doing to re-affirm your love for him?

WIFE:

Yes; Ani l'dodi v'dodi lee.

(WIFE GIVES HUSBAND HIS RING)

(DANCERS DANCE ANI L'DODI SONG)
           
LEADER: (AARONIC BLESSING)

YHVH bless you and keep you.  YHVH make His face to shine upon you and be gracious unto you.  YHVH lift up His countenance upon you, and give you peace.  In the Name of The Prince of Peace, Yeshua our-Messiah; Amaine.

(LEADER SINGS...)

Y'-varech'-cha YHVH v'yish-marechah.  Yaer YHVH panav aelechah veechu-nechah.  Yisah YHVH panav  aelechah v'ya-saem l'chah shalom. B'Shem Yeshua M'sheechaenu Sar HaShalom; Amaine.

(HUSBAND BREAKS GLASS; KISSES THE BRIDE.)
